khawir commited on
Commit
c0aa865
1 Parent(s): 4c9cdd5

Update Dockerfile

Browse files
Files changed (1) hide show
  1. Dockerfile +13 -1
Dockerfile CHANGED
@@ -15,4 +15,16 @@ WORKDIR $HOME/app
15
 
16
  COPY --chown=user . $HOME/app
17
 
18
- CMD ["uvicorn", "app.main:app", "--host", "0.0.0.0", "--port", "7860"]
 
 
 
 
 
 
 
 
 
 
 
 
 
15
 
16
  COPY --chown=user . $HOME/app
17
 
18
+ RUN --mount=type=secret,id=SECRET_KEY,mode=0444,required=true \
19
+ cat /run/secrets/SECRET_KEY > /test
20
+
21
+ RUN --mount=type=secret,id=ALGORITHM,mode=0444,required=true \
22
+ cat /run/secrets/ALGORITHM > /test
23
+
24
+ RUN --mount=type=secret,id=SUPERUSER_USERNAME,mode=0444,required=true \
25
+ cat /run/secrets/SUPERUSER_USERNAME > /test
26
+
27
+ RUN --mount=type=secret,id=SUPERUSER_PASSWORD,mode=0444,required=true \
28
+ cat /run/secrets/SUPERUSER_PASSWORD > /test
29
+
30
+ CMD ["uvicorn", "app.main:app", "--host", "0.0.0.0", "--port", "7860"]